Brainstorming
Introdução¶
O brainstorm é uma técnica de elicitação de requisitos que consiste em reunir a equipe e discutir sobre diversos tópicos gerais do projeto apresentados no documento problema de negócio. No brainstorm o diálogo é incentivado e críticas são evitadas para permitir que todos colaborem com suas próprias ideias.
Metodologia¶
A equipe se reuniu para debater ideias gerais sobre o projeto via discord, começou dia 3/9 e terminou no mesmo dia, onde o Arthur Riess Cunha foi o moderador, direcionando a equipe com questões pré-elaboradas, e transcrevendo as respostas para o documento.
Brainstorm¶
Versão 1.0¶
Perguntas¶
1. Qual o objetivo principal da aplicação?¶
Simplificar e centralizar o sistema de aplicação e gerenciamento de vagas de monitoria na IBMEC.
2. Como será o processo para cadastrar um novo cliente?¶
Aluno se cadastra manualmente, inserindo seus dados pessoais (Matrícula, curso, email institucional, senha de acesso, qualidades...) Para o professor a lógica é a mesma, porém possui sua própria interface de professor.
3. Como será a forma de adicionar produtos?¶
O professor encarregado da disciplina poderá criar vagas, preenchendo as seguintes informações: 1 - Disciplina 2 - Requisitos (CR mínimo ou outros) 3 - Detalhes da vaga (Carga horária, número de vagas, remuneração (se houver))
4. Outras perguntas pertinentes ao contexto¶
O aluno terá sua interface própria, no qual pode ver as vagas disponíveis, seus detalhes e requisitos impostos pelo professor, além de poder ver o status da sua aplicação (Recusada, Aceita, Em análise)
5. "Outras perguntas pertinentes ao contexto"¶
Seria interessante uma funcionalidade para poder exportar dados para a coordenação a respeito do número de aplicações, estatísticas e insights.
Requisitos elicitados¶
ID | Descrição |
---|---|
BS01 | O cliente poderá fazer cadastro |
BS02 | O cliente poderá ver as vagas disponíveis em sua interface |
BS03 | O cliente poderá se aplicar as vagas |
BS04 | O cliente poderá fazer login com suas informações |
BS05 | O cliente poderá editar seu perfil |
BS06 | O cliente deve ter uma página para tirar dúvidas sobre a vaga |
BS07 | O cliente poderá analisar o status da sua aplicação |
BS08 | O professor poderá criar vagas |
BS09 | O professor poderá editar vagas |
BS10 | O professor poderá criar requisitos |
BS11 | O professor poderá dar feedback aos candidatos |
BS12 | O professor poderá excluir vagas |
BS13 | O professor poderá analisar as candidaturas |
BS14 | A direção deve receber dados e insights sobre as candidaturas e vagas |
BS15 | A direção poderá fazer cadastro |
Conclusão¶
Através da aplicação da técnica, esclarecemos os requisitos do projeto e criamos um direcionamento para começar a desenvolver com mais clareza no futuro.
Referências Bibliográficas¶
BARBOSA, S. D. J; DA SILVA, B. S. Interação humano-computador. Elsevier, 2010.
Autores¶
Data | Versão | Descrição | Autor(es) |
---|---|---|---|
3/9 | 1.0 | Criação do documento | Equipe Elon Musk |